Speech Title: Next-generation cloud computing architecture and intelligent scheduling system
Speech Abstract: Since the advent of cloud computing, elastic computing (EC) has become a standard architecture for resource allocation and scheduling. EC usually allocates computing resources based on predefined flavor specifications, such as virtual machines or containers. However, these features are usually limited by a fixed CPU-memory ratio and usually fail to meet the actual resource requirements of applications. As a result, cloud service providers' resource allocation rates are close to saturation (greater than 80%), but utilization is low (less than 25%). This study introduces Flexible Computing (FC), a new resource allocation and scheduling approach. Unlike elastic computing EC, FC allocates resources based on application resource usage, which is derived from the actual resource consumption of the workload, rather than relying on fixed flavor specifications.
